Skip to content

Latest commit

 

History

History
34 lines (27 loc) · 2.8 KB

README.md

File metadata and controls

34 lines (27 loc) · 2.8 KB

MARS - Multi-channel Automatic Response Sysytem (Мультиканальная система обработки запросов )

  • Автоматизация для колл-центров
  • Обработка информации голосом и тоновыми сигналами с клавиатуры
  • Обработка входящих и исходящих звонков
  • Сбор информации от абонентов и занесение их в учетные системы

Лицензия:

GNU GPLv3

Описание:

  • для обозначения стабильных версий предусмотрены тэги
  • для работы проекта с голосом нужен SoX
  • для воспроизведения звука необходим speaker и его зависимости
  • для захвата данных с микрофона node-microphone и его зависимости
  • для корректной работы необходимо использовать Node.js версии >= v6.11.4
  • рекомендованные операционные системы: Windows 8/Windows 10/ Ubuntu 16.04/ Debian 8.0.1/

Установка:

  1. скачать и установить LTS версию node.js (с сайта https://nodejs.org/en/)
  2. скачать и установить git (для linux есть в репозиториях, для windows качаем последнюю версию с http://git-scm.com/download/win )
  3. сделать локальную копию стабильной версии проекта: git clone -b stable https://github.com/komunikator/mars.git
  4. установить программу sox (для linux есть в репозиторях, для windows качаем последнюю версию с http://sourceforge.net/projects/sox/ )
  5. установить необходимые зависимости для speaker, согласно Вашей ОС ( https://www.npmjs.com/package/speaker )
  6. установить необходимые зависимости для node-microphone, согласно Вашей ОС ( https://www.npmjs.com/package/node-microphone )
  7. установить зависимости проекта командой npm i

Запуск:

node mars

Для более подробного описания процесса установки и запуска можно обратиться к инструкции MARS. Руководство по установке и запуску.